#65bce4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#65bce4 is composed of 39.6% red, 73.7%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.7% cyan, 17.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 198.9 degrees, a saturation of 70.2% and a lightness of 64.5%. #65bce4 color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#0079c9.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#65bce4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#65bce4 has RGB values of R:101, G:188,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 6667492.

Shades and Tints of #65bce4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a0d is the darkest color, while #fbf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#65bce4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a5a5 is the less saturated color, while #50c4f9 is the most saturated one.
